>>10059060
>But why does the TG version of Shinobi have different music?

shinobi has all the arcade music
unfortunately, asmik cheaped out and made it a 3 megabit cart, so it has a lot of omisions
>several enemies cut
>missing black tiger level
>missing bonus stages
>no sword, so you just shuriken everyone
>no bullet powerup

port would've been much better if handled by nec avenue, though the music might've been a bit worse. they used these white noise drums on a bunch of sega ports

The CD add-on allowed for voice acting and tons of sprites. They used this for a lot of text and voice acting heavy games... which do not translate AT ALL. It along with the Saturn are the most Japanese required consoles, and outsider fans tend to focus on the arcade ports and action titles. There's a trickle of fan-translations over the years.

The console had a shit ton of these genres that never show up on Engish "best" releases:

>rpgs
>adventure games
>simulation/management
>visual novels
>Quiz games
>board games
>majong

>>10062838
>but what was the PC Engine?

1. More shooting games (MD was their main competitor for that)
2. Some platformers (but MD and SFC had the edge on that overall)
3. Weird experimental titles no one else had
4. Endless voice acted animu movie games in various formats.

Nowhere else are you gonna get 1 hour of voice acted cut-scenes in 1993 in an rpg. Or a board game with voice acting and a fully fleshed out story. Or a Mahjong quest game with cutscenes. Or a voice acted Romance sim.

Look through issues of PC Engine Fan to get an idea what the console was like in glorious Nippon.

Whether these games are GOOD or not depends on your tastes. It's certainly a novelty to have a voice acted visual novel or sim game with anime aestetics in the early 90's.

Fun fact; Akira Kitamura (Mega Man 1-2 director) was cutscene artist for the PC Engine version of Virgin Dreams. The game is a sim/story game where you follow a young aspiring model as she advances her career. It's often mistaken for a porn game, but aside from a few riske scenes, it's straight.

Oh tha'ts another thing. A few PCE-CD games fetured some nudity.

>>10063926
1, 3 and 4 are best on pce. 3 and 4 are cut-down ports on genesis/snes. 1 is a different game on genesis but it's shit

2 is just not a great game, and there's very different versions of it. the fanbase considers the x68k version to be the best (it's like a 16-bit remake of the 8-bit versions)

2 on genesis is a weird "super deformed" version that runs faster but plays sloppy, its based on the pce one
